The Pinnacle of Algebraic Problem Solving

Algebra for JEE by Sameer Bansal (published by GRB Publications) is widely regarded as one of the most challenging, thought-provoking, and rewarding problem books for JEE Advanced mathematics. It is strictly designed for top-tier aspirants looking to push their logical boundaries and secure a top rank.

Book Snapshot

  • Author: Sameer Bansal
  • Publisher: GRB Publications
  • Best For: JEE Advanced Rank Boosting
  • Difficulty Level: Very High (Advanced Only)
  • Prerequisites: Complete mastery of basic theory and JEE Main level problems

Overview, Unique Strengths & Study Strategy

Unique Strengths: What separates Sameer Bansal Algebra from the rest of the market is its ability to blend multiple disjoint concepts into a single question. A question might start as a Matrix problem, transition into a Sequence and Series summation, and end with a Probability calculation. This is exactly how the modern JEE Advanced paper is structured.

Target Audience & Prerequisites: This book is strictly for students targeting under AIR 2000 in JEE Advanced. If you are struggling with basic algebraic formulas or if your primary goal is JEE Main, do NOT start with this book. You must have already completed your coaching sheets or a foundational book like Cengage before attempting Sameer Bansal.

Difficulty Progression & Hardest Chapters: The book starts tough and gets tougher. While it covers all of algebra, the chapters on Complex Numbers and Permutation & Combination (P&C) are considered absolute goldmines that will thoroughly humble even the best students.

Study Strategy: Treat this as a final revision tool. Do not try to solve the entire book in one sitting. Take 15-20 questions at a time and apply a strict time limit (e.g., 1 hour). Do not look at the solutions immediately; give every problem at least 15 minutes of deep thought.

Comparisons & Alternatives: The only book that rivals Sameer Bansal Algebra in pure difficulty is Vikas Gupta's Black Book. While the Black Book is fantastic for Calculus and overall practice, Sameer Bansal is often favored specifically for mastering pure algebraic manipulations.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sameer Bansal Algebra

Which is better: Sameer Bansal Algebra or Black Book?

Both are legendary for JEE Advanced. Black Book (Vikas Gupta) is excellent for overall problem solving across all units, while Sameer Bansal is often considered slightly superior for purely Algebraic manipulations and thought-provoking P&C/Probability problems.

Are Sameer Bansal Algebra solutions available?

Yes, detailed solutions for Sameer Bansal Algebra are provided so you can cross-check your methods. However, we highly recommend trying problems for at least 15 minutes before looking at the solution.

Is Sameer Bansal Algebra sufficient for JEE Main?

Sameer Bansal is actually massive overkill for JEE Main. It is strictly a JEE Advanced rank-boosting book. For JEE Main, a book like RD Sharma Objective or Wiley's Objective is much more appropriate.

When should I start solving Sameer Bansal Algebra?

You should only start this book after you have fully completed your base theory from Cengage, Arihant, or your coaching modules. It is best used as a final revision tool in the last 6 months before JEE Advanced.

Which chapters are the hardest in Sameer Bansal Algebra?

The chapters on Permutation & Combination (P&C) and Complex Numbers are considered notoriously difficult and exceptionally well-crafted, perfectly replicating the trickiness of actual JEE Advanced papers.
